β€˜They’re emboldened’: British far-right activists step up harassment of asylum seekers in northern France Aid groups say rise of far-right rhetoric in politics has fed into intimidation, vandalism and hate graffiti around migrant camps

The Guardian reports far- right groups harassing people seeking safety in northern France, destroying water supplies and invading sleeping spaces. This is where the politics of division leads. We need leaders who choose hope and unity. Read the article here: https://bit.ly/4sRPMn2

β€˜Every human being deserves dignity’: asylum seeker in Essex hotel calls for understanding Man housed at hotel targeted in protests writes letter urging people not to resort to harmful stereotypes

"I did not come here seeking wealth or running from poverty. In fact, I had a stable life back in my country, Yemen.

"What forced me to leave was not economic hardship, but persecution and fear for my safety and the safety of my family."
